Sage Bionetworks is a nonprofit leader in open science that builds and operates data platforms and community-driven tools to accelerate biomedical research and discovery. The organization enables secure data sharing, large-scale dataset reuse, and collaborative analysis—often using machine learning and AI—to advance understanding of diseases, biomarkers, and therapeutic responses. Sage emphasizes radical collaboration, transparency, and infrastructure (e. g. , the Synapse platform and a Python client) to support researchers, challenges, and portals across a wide range of biomedical domains.

• Lead development of policies, processes, and structures overseeing research design, data collection, analysis, and dissemination • Collaborate with research consortia, scientific working groups, and institutional partners on ethical and accountable research and data sharing • Design and implement governance systems protecting research participants and scientific integrity • Evaluate data sensitivity and design and apply data governance approaches such as data access controls • Assess emerging privacy considerations and update compliance methods • Monitor adherence to ethical, legal, and institutional requirements • Contribute to incident investigations and CAPA plans • Monitor activities and report to stakeholders • Lead governance initiatives for responsible application of AI and other emerging technologies • Develop and implement data-sharing and governance standards, protocols, training materials, and presentations • Lead partnerships with internal teams and external collaborators • Respond to data access requests and provide user support • Design and oversee governance frameworks and data privacy guidelines • Direct custom data governance systems and execution of complex data-sharing agreements • Lead internal and external investigations and contribute to high-level audit reporting • Develop and negotiate data-sharing terms • Identify governance gaps and modernize workflows and documentation using AI and emerging technologies • Lead privacy and compliance training programs as a subject matter expert
• Bachelor’s degree in a relevant field, such as life sciences, public health, public administration, or social sciences • 7+ years of professional experience in a research setting involving human biomedical data • Knowledge and experience with laws, regulations, and best practices related to human research data • Experience preparing and submitting Institutional Review Board (IRB) materials, preferably including multi-site protocols • Human subjects research regulatory experience • Experience with legal language or data sharing agreement review • Experience developing or improving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) or process documentation • Knowledge of incident investigation, root cause analysis, and Corrective Action/Preventive Action (CAPA) plans • Organizational skills and attention to detail • Experience with documentation/task management tools such as Google Suite, MS Suite, Confluence, and Jira • Written and verbal communication skills across various audiences and mediums • Understanding of F.A.I.R. data sharing and ethical research principles for human biomedical research • Strong digital literacy and eagerness to learn new software and tools • Ability to navigate ambiguity as project and business needs change • Ability to sustain focus and concentration during computer-based and reading-intensive tasks • Ability to work effectively under deadlines • Strong problem-solving and analytical skills • Flexibility to adapt to changing environments, priorities, and multitask • Effective verbal and written communication skills • Ability to work well in a team and maintain professionalism • Ability to follow company policies, procedures, and relevant laws and regulations • Travel required at least twice per year for on-site events in Seattle, Washington
